The cost of riding in a cab is $3.00 plus $0.75 per mile. The equation that represents this relation is y = 0.75x +3, where x is
Gemiola [76]

Answer:

Yes, the relation is a function.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

The equation that represents the cost of riding a cab is given as:

y=0.75x+3

Where, 'x' is the number of miles traveled and 'y' is the the total cost of the trip.

The above equation represents a line as it is of the form y=mx+b which represents a line with constant slope.

Now, in order to plot this equation, we need at least two points.

Now, let x =0, then

y=0.75(0)+3=3. So, (0, 3) is a point on the line.

Let x =1, then

y=0.75(1)+3=3.75. So, (1, 3.75) is a point on the line.

Plot these two points on a graph and draw a line passing through these two points.

Now, for a relation to be a function, it should pass the vertical line test.

According to vertical line test, vertical lines passing through the graph must cut the graph at only 1 point for the graph to represent a function.

Here, we observe that vertical lines passing through the line will intersect the line only at one point. So, it represent a function.
